
I believe in being fully transparent about Pickles so that he can find the right home and be successful. Pickles has a history of resource guarding and has bitten both my other dog and my child. The incidents have occurred around high-value items such as food, treats, or chew bones. Outside of those situations, he is not an aggressive dog, but these are serious behaviors that need to be acknowledged and managed appropriately. For this reason, I believe Pickles would do best in an adult-only home with no children and ideally as the only pet. He would benefit from an experienced owner who understands resource guarding and is willing to provide structure, consistency, and continued training. This decision has been heartbreaking because when it is just Pickles and me, without other pets or children in the environment, he is truly an incredible dog. He is affectionate, intelligent, loyal, and loves being part of everyday life. I genuinely believe he can thrive in the right home where his triggers can be managed and set up for success. My goal is not simply to find him a home, but to find him the right home.
